Tour de France Femmes
Recent Developments
The sixth level of the Tour de France Femmes witnessed an exhilarating turn of events on Thursday. Maeva Squiban, a French cyclist, executed a flawless and well-coordinated attack during the final climb, culminating in a triumphant win.
Leaderboard Update
Despite Squiban’s impressive victory, Kimberley Le Court from Mauritius successfully maintained her lead in the competition. She retained the coveted yellow jersey, a symbol of her position as the guide and current leader of the Tour de France Femmes.
